序言

用心生活,用力向上,微笑前行,就是对生活最好的回馈。

 本专栏说明:

主要是记录在分享知识的同时,不定时给大家送书的活动。

参与方式:

赠书数量:本次送书 3 本,评论区抽3位小伙伴送书
活动时间:截止到 2023-04-20 20:00:00

抽奖方式:利用程序进行抽奖。

参与方式:关注博主、点赞、收藏,评论区评论 "人生苦短,我爱web!"

web发展史

Web的发展史可以大致分为以下几个阶段:

  1. Web 1.0时代 (1990年代中期)

  2. Web 2.0时代(2000年代初期)

  3. Web 3.0时代(当前)

1 web1.0

Web的初期阶段,主要是以静态网页为主,内容以文本和图片为主,用户只能通过超链接进行简单的页面跳转和浏览。Web 1.0时代的网站大多由个人或企业自己搭建和维护,缺乏标准化的技术和工具支持。

Web 1.0是指互联网的早期阶段,大约从1991年至2004年左右。在这个阶段,Web主要是以静态网页为主,网页内容主要是由HTML、CSS、JavaScript等技术组成,网页的内容呈现形式以文本和图片为主,用户主要是通过超链接进行简单的页面跳转和浏览。

Web 1.0时代的技术基础主要是HTML、CSS和JavaScript等前端技术,后端技术主要是CGI、ASP、PHP等脚本语言。网站的部署和维护主要是通过FTP等传统的文件传输协议进行,缺乏现代化的开发、测试和部署工具。

总的来说,Web 1.0时代是互联网的初期阶段,虽然网站的功能和交互性较低,但它为后续的Web发展和演化奠定了基础。

Web 1.0时代的经验和教训也启示我们,在Web的发展和演化中,需要不断地引入新的技术和概念,不断地改进用户体验和互动性,才能更好地满足用户的需求和期望。

2 web2.0

时间,大约从2004年至2010年左右。在这个阶段,Web主要是以动态网页和社交媒体为主,内容更加丰富多样化,用户可以通过Web应用程序进行更加复杂的交互和操作。

Web的第二个阶段,主要是以动态网页和社交媒体为主,内容更加丰富多样化,用户可以通过Web应用程序进行更加复杂的交互和操作。

Web 2.0时代的网站大多采用开放标准和技术,如Ajax、XML、RSS等,用户可以通过浏览器和Web应用程序进行更加灵活的操作和交互。

此外,Web 2.0时代的网站开发和管理也得到了极大的改进和提升,出现了许多新的工具和框架,如jQuery、Bootstrap、React等,使得网站的开发和维护更加高效、便捷。

同时,Web 2.0也促进了开放数据、开放知识等概念的发展,使得互联网变得更加开放、透明和共享。

Web 2.0时代的网站主要以社交媒体、博客和在线办公应用为主,如Facebook、Twitter、WordPress、Google Docs等。

这些网站的特点是用户生成的内容多,个性化程度高,交互性强,用户可以通过分享、评论、点赞等方式与其他用户进行互动。

Web 2.0时代是互联网的一个重要阶段,它为互联网的发展和演化带来了重大的影响和变革。

4 web3.0

Web 3.0是指互联网的第三个阶段,也被称为“智能互联网”或“语义互联网”,其主要特点是实现了数据的智能化、语义化和分布式存储,使得互联网可以更加智能、开放、安全和去中心化。

Web 3.0的相关技术包括:

  1. 人工智能(AI):Web 3.0时代的互联网需要具备智能化的能力,可以通过机器学习、自然语言处理等技术对数据进行分析和处理,提高数据的质量和价值。

  2. 区块链(Blockchain):Web 3.0的互联网需要具备去中心化的能力,可以通过区块链技术实现分布式存储和去中心化的管理,保护数据的安全和隐私。

  3. 语义Web(Semantic Web):Web 3.0的互联网需要具备语义化的能力,可以通过RDF、OWL等技术对数据进行描述和表示,使得数据能够被机器理解和利用。

  4. Web服务(Web Services):Web 3.0的互联网需要具备开放性的能力,可以通过Web服务实现跨平台、跨语言的数据交互和共享。

  5. 物联网(Internet of Things,IoT):Web 3.0的互联网需要具备智能化的能力,可以通过物联网技术实现设备之间的互联、数据共享和智能化管理。

  6. 3D技术(3D Web):Web 3.0的互联网需要具备虚拟化和沉浸式的能力,可以通过3D技术实现虚拟现实、增强现实等新的应用和体验。

  7. 大数据(Big Data):Web 3.0的互联网需要具备数据驱动的能力,可以通过大数据技术实现对海量数据的处理和分析,提高数据的价值和意义。

总的来说,Web 3.0的相关技术是多种多样的,它们共同构成了一个智能、开放、安全和去中心化的互联网生态系统。这些技术的不断发展和应用将带来更多新的应用和机会,推动互联网的发展和演化。

总结

Web的发展史可以看作是一个不断演化和发展的过程,不断地引入新的技术和概念,不断地提高用户体验和互动性。

随着Web技术的不断发展和演化,我们可以期待更加智能、便捷和个性化的Web应用程序和服务的到来。

图书推荐-《从零开始读懂Web3》

Web3正频繁出现在公众视野中,然而受阻于晦涩难懂的技术原理及陌生又拗口的专业术语,很多人对此望而却步。

但是,Web3不仅仅是技术和金融语境,它和每个人的生活都息息相关。这本书试图用 通俗的语言、简单的结构、翔实的案例,目的是让零基础的读者迅速掌握Web3的核心要义。

本书作者,Anymose,是中国人民大学传播学硕士,Inverse DAO(Web3投资研究机构)发起人,曾供职知名风险资本分析师,具有丰富的Web3理论研究、项目投资、运营实践经验,帮助Qredo、Fetch、Gitcoin等诸多项目进行新一代信息化建设。

Inverse DAO,作为深耕Web3的研究机构,将带我们通过纵向时间线、横向技术线来立体、客观、完整地理解Web3。通过学习本书我们既可以快速读懂行业,也可以躬身实践参与。

希望这本书可以抛砖引玉,启迪你的智慧之光,发现Web3更多、更广、更深的奥秘,助你在新的科技浪潮下,无往而不胜。

Web3重构世界,不止于科技,更是一种思潮。所有这一切,都在重构我们的工作与生活,让我们从零开始,一起走进新一代互联网的世界。

本次送书 3 本     评论区抽3位小伙伴送书
活动时间:截止到 2023-04-20 20:00:00

抽奖方式:利用程序进行抽奖。

参与方式:关注博主、点赞、收藏,评论区评论 "人生苦短,我爱web!"

迫不及待的小伙伴也可以访问下面的链接了解详情:

从零开始读懂Web3 一起走进新一代互联网世界

【前端】从零开始读懂Web3相关推荐

  1. 从零开始读懂Web3:一起走进新一代互联网世界

    前言: 技术书籍是学习技术知识的重要资源之一.读技术书可以帮助我们学习新技能和知识,技术书籍提供了可靠的.全面的信息,帮助我们快速学习新技能和知识.同时技术书籍有助于保持你的竞争力,因为它们提供了最新 ...

  2. 一文读懂 Web3:互联网发展的新时代

    撰文:James Beck @ConsenSys 编译:0x13.Kxp @BlockBeats Web3 这个新鲜的专业名词诞生于 2014 年,在一开始,它被用来描述实现去中心化共识的新型协议,而 ...

  3. 一文读懂 Web3:互联网发展的新时代还是骗局?

    作者 | Ivan Mehta 译者 | 卢鑫旺 策划 | 千山 就目前来说,关于Web3的定义仍未有公论.但可以肯定的是,在现有的假想中,Web3绝不是网速更快.数据容量更大的web2,而是基于全新 ...

  4. 读书感受 之 《从零开始读懂金融学》

      这本书是关于经济及金融相关的基础书,全书共294页,整体分两部分,前面一部分介绍金融中的一些基本的经济概念,从各金融市场概念到各类金融机构的一般性介绍:后面一部分围绕个人理财进行相关概念的介绍和原 ...

  5. 从零开始读懂物理学:探索自然的奥秘

  6. 前端面试必会 | 一文读懂 JavaScript 中的 this 关键字

    this 是一个令无数 JavaScript 编程者又爱又恨的知识点.它的重要性毋庸置疑,然而真正想掌握它却并非易事.希望本文可以帮助大家理解 this. JavaScript 中的 this Jav ...

  7. [SLAM前端系列]——一文读懂ICP

    今天突然发现这篇博客写的并不详细,配不上一文读懂这四个字,特此回来更新. 我们知道SLAM可以用2D/3D雷达或者相机实现(视觉SLAM).由于笔者是激光SLAM工程师,所以本文的ICP都是在激光雷达 ...

  8. 超级干货 :一文读懂大数据计算框架与平台(升级版)

    1. 前言 计算机的基本工作就是处理数据,包括磁盘文件中的数据,通过网络传输的数据流或数据包,数据库中的结构化数据等.随着互联网.物联网等技术得到越来越广泛的应用,数据规模不断增加,TB.PB量级成为 ...

  9. 一文读懂SAP Leonardo物联网平台

    本文比较系统.全面地介绍了SAP Leonardo IoT平台,全文总共分为6部分: 1.连接与赋能 – SAP Leonardo IoT 2.边缘层 – SAP Leonardo Edge 3.平台 ...

最新文章

  1. nvidia命令不可用linux,在Linux命令行下如何正确配置nVIDIA显卡
  2. 使用Typescript的巧妙React上下文技巧-不是Redux
  3. 微信小程序python数据交换代码_一个微信小程序通过 DDP 协议和 Meteor 后端交换数据的简单例子...
  4. Java和HTML有什么区别?哪个更重要?
  5. java红包雨_Java升职加薪课开发企业年会红包雨场景项目实战视频教程
  6. 【COCOS CREATOR 系列教程之二】脚本开发篇事件监听、常用函数等示例整合
  7. 前端学习(3280):iterator
  8. 小程序分享到朋友圈_如何给小程序添加分享朋友圈
  9. LaTeX引用多篇bibtex格式文献
  10. 分析业务模型-类图(Class Diagram)(上)
  11. jquery easy ui 1.3.4 事件与方法的使用(3)
  12. linux应用小技巧
  13. php curlopen,php自动提交表单的方法(基于fsockopen与curl)
  14. 【工具使用系列】关于 MATLAB 非线性控制,你需要知道的事
  15. CSS选择器的优先级计算
  16. 大数据如何改善社会治理:国外“大数据社会福祉”运动的案例分析和借鉴
  17. php utf8 正则中文表达式
  18. 统计android代码行数据,Android Studio代码行数统计插件Statistics
  19. Horizontally Visible Segments
  20. 阿里达摩院发布并开源“通义”大模型,AI底座之上促场景创新

热门文章

  1. linux 如何进入bios设置密码,装了linux无法进入bios设置密码
  2. 【云服务架构】大健康之医疗影像云解决方案
  3. Linux关闭端口的命令
  4. 023,递归2 疯狂的兔子
  5. 25. BufferedReader的readLine()方法
  6. 儿子小学三年级的奥数题
  7. 吃货联盟订餐系统1.1-面向对象+数组
  8. 【GoCN酷Go推荐】 ​文本差异对比工具 go-diff
  9. Deep Fashion衣服时尚数据集
  10. Trafodion日期运算——DATEADD函数